lebaudantoine 69c6e58017 🔒️(backend) add application validation when consuming external JWT
Token generation already verifies that the application is active, but this
guarantee was not enforced when the token was used. This change adds a
runtime check to ensure the client_id claim matches an existing and active
application when evaluating permissions.

This also introduces an emergency revocation mechanism, allowing all previously
issued tokens for a given application to be invalidated if the application is
disabled.

lebaudantoine 6742f5d19d (backend) monitor throttling rate failure through sentry
Use a mixin, introduced by @lunika in the shared
backend library to monitor throttling behavior.

The mixin tracks when throttling limits are reached, sending errors to Sentry
to trigger alerts when configured. This helps detect misconfigurations,
fine-tune throttling settings, and identify suspicious operations.

This enables safely increasing API throttling limits while ensuring stability,
providing confidence that higher limits won’t break the system.

# Deployment on Scalingo
This guide explains how to deploy La Suite Meet on [Scalingo](https://scalingo.com/) using the [Suite Numérique buildpack](https://github.com/suitenumerique/buildpack).
## Overview
Scalingo is a Platform-as-a-Service (PaaS) that simplifies application deployment. This setup uses a custom buildpack to handle both the frontend (Vite) and backend (Django) builds, serving them through Nginx.
## Prerequisites
- A Scalingo account
- Scalingo CLI installed (optional but recommended)
- A PostgreSQL database addon
- A Redis addon (for caching and sessions)
## Step 1: Create Your App
Create a new app on Scalingo using `scalingo` cli or using the [Scalingo dashboard](https://dashboard.scalingo.com/).
## Step 2: Provision Addons
Add the required PostgreSQL and Redis services.
This will set the following environment variables automatically:
- `SCALINGO_POSTGRESQL_URL` - Database connection string
- `SCALINGO_REDIS_URL` - Redis connection string
## Step 3: Configure Environment Variables
Set the following environment variables in your Scalingo app:
### Buildpack Configuration
```bash
scalingo env-set BUILDPACK_URL="https://github.com/suitenumerique/buildpack#main"
scalingo env-set LASUITE_APP_NAME="meet"
scalingo env-set LASUITE_BACKEND_DIR="."
scalingo env-set LASUITE_FRONTEND_DIR="src/frontend/"
scalingo env-set LASUITE_NGINX_DIR="."
scalingo env-set LASUITE_SCRIPT_POSTCOMPILE="bin/buildpack_postcompile.sh"
scalingo env-set LASUITE_SCRIPT_POSTFRONTEND="bin/buildpack_postfrontend.sh"
```
### Database and Cache
```bash
scalingo env-set DATABASE_URL="\$SCALINGO_POSTGRESQL_URL"
scalingo env-set REDIS_URL="\$SCALINGO_REDIS_URL"
```
### Django Settings
```bash
scalingo env-set DJANGO_SETTINGS_MODULE="meet.settings"
scalingo env-set DJANGO_CONFIGURATION="Production"
scalingo env-set DJANGO_SECRET_KEY="<generate-a-secure-secret-key>"
scalingo env-set DJANGO_ALLOWED_HOSTS="my-meet-app.osc-fr1.scalingo.io"
```
### OIDC Authentication
Configure your OIDC provider (e.g., Keycloak, Authentik):
```bash
scalingo env-set OIDC_OP_BASE_URL="https://auth.yourdomain.com/realms/meet"
scalingo env-set OIDC_RP_CLIENT_ID="meet-client-id"
scalingo env-set OIDC_RP_CLIENT_SECRET="<your-client-secret>"
scalingo env-set OIDC_RP_SIGN_ALGO="RS256"
```
### LiveKit Configuration
Meet requires a LiveKit server for video conferencing:
```bash
scalingo env-set LIVEKIT_API_URL="wss://livekit.yourdomain.com"
scalingo env-set LIVEKIT_API_KEY="<your-livekit-api-key>"
scalingo env-set LIVEKIT_API_SECRET="<your-livekit-api-secret>"
```
### Email Configuration (Optional)
For email notifications see https://doc.scalingo.com/platform/app/sending-emails:
```bash
scalingo env-set DJANGO_EMAIL_HOST="smtp.example.org"
scalingo env-set DJANGO_EMAIL_PORT="587"
scalingo env-set DJANGO_EMAIL_HOST_USER="<smtp-user>"
scalingo env-set DJANGO_EMAIL_HOST_PASSWORD="<smtp-password>"
scalingo env-set DJANGO_EMAIL_USE_TLS="True"
scalingo env-set DJANGO_EMAIL_FROM="meet@yourdomain.com"
```
## Step 4: Deploy
Deploy your application:
```bash
git push scalingo main
```
The Procfile will automatically:
1. Build the frontend (Vite)
2. Build the backend (Django)
3. Run the post-compile script (cleanup)
4. Run the post-frontend script (move assets and prepare for deployment)
5. Start Nginx and Gunicorn
6. Run django migrations
## Step 5: Create superuser
After the first deployment, create an admin user:
```bash
scalingo run python manage.py createsuperuser
```
## Custom Domain (Optional)
To use a custom domain:
1. Add the domain in Scalingo dashboard
2. Update `DJANGO_ALLOWED_HOSTS` with your custom domain
3. Configure your DNS to point to Scalingo
```bash
scalingo domains-add meet.yourdomain.com
scalingo env-set DJANGO_ALLOWED_HOSTS="meet.yourdomain.com,my-meet-app.osc-fr1.scalingo.io"
```
## Custom Logo (Optional)
To use a custom logo, set the `CUSTOM_LOGO_URL` environment variable with an HTTPS URL pointing to an SVG item (max 5MB):
```bash
scalingo env-set CUSTOM_LOGO_URL="https://cdn.yourdomain.com/logo.svg"
```
## Troubleshooting
### Check Logs
```bash
scalingo logs --tail
```
### Common Issues
1. **Build fails**: Check that all required environment variables are set
2. **Database connection error**: Verify `DATABASE_URL` is correctly set to `$SCALINGO_POSTGRESQL_URL`
3. **Static files not served**: Ensure the buildpack post-frontend script ran successfully
4. **OIDC errors**: Verify your OIDC provider configuration and callback URLs
### Useful Commands
```bash
# Open a console
scalingo run bash
# Restart the app
scalingo restart
# Scale containers
scalingo scale web:2
# One-off command
scalingo run python manage.py shell
```
## Architecture
On Scalingo, the application runs as follows:
1. **Build Phase**: The buildpack compiles both frontend and backend
2. **Runtime**:
- Nginx serves static files and proxies to the backend
- Gunicorn runs the Django WSGI application
- Both processes are managed by the `bin/buildpack_start.sh` script
